The Capela do Senhor da Pedra, located on the Praia do Senhor da Pedra in Gulpilhares, Vila Nova de Gaia, Portugal, was built in 1763 on a rocky outcrop by the sea. The chapel is significant for its hexagonal design and baroque altarpieces, reflecting its historical roots, possibly linked to ancient pagan worship. It hosts an annual pilgrimage on the Sunday of the Holy Trinity, drawing visitors for its rich traditions. Key attractions include the intricate altar and the panels of azulejos that provide insight into the region's past.
